How grammatical structures are systematically related to meanings, uses and situations.
ValentinkaMS [17]

Answer:

In English grammar, sentence structure is the arrangement of words, phrases, and clauses in a sentence. The grammatical function or meaning of a sentence is dependent on this structural organization, which is also called syntax or syntactic structure
